Corrosion Protection for 6061 Structural Aluminum Container




April 15, 2014

Q. Hello,

I am looking for a solution for the final protection coating on a structural box made of Aluminum 6061 structural channel and I-beams. The box is large 12 x 8 x 8 1/2' tall. The destination is in a slat environment near the ocean. We built the box using std structural brackets and huck fasteners. All is assembled and out for soda blast to remove the mill finish and markings.

The question is what is recommended to complete this for best corrosion resistance ? Anodize is out of the question due to size. Alodine is there, but I see conflicting recommendations. Any other ideas would be appreciated. Powdercoat is possible but not the favorite answer ...
